"Few people today know what REAL mincemeat should taste like, today's version paling in comparison to the mincemeat that has been a household tradition for centuries. Give this traditional version a try and even if you've always hated mincemeat this may just be the one to convert you!..."
INGREDIENTS
•
1 pound (450g) finely chopped beef steak ((optional but HIGHLY recommended, otherwise use an extra 1 1/2 cups raisins or currants))
•
Note: Traditionally made with beef or lamb and can also be made with wild game
•
1 1/4 cups (330g) raisins
•
1 1/4 cups (330g) currants
•
1/2 cup (150g) golden raisins
•
2 cups finely chopped tart apple
•
200 grams shredded beef suet
•
2 cups (450g) dark brown sugar
•
2 tablespoons candied lemon peel
•
2 tablespoons candied orange peel
•
STRONGLY recommend using Homemade Candied Citrus Peel ((click link for recipe))
•
1 1/2 tablespoons (50g) finely chopped blanched almonds
•
1 lemon, its zest and juice
•
2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
•
1 1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
•
1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
•
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
•
1/4 teaspoon ground allspice
•
1/4 teaspoon ground mace
•
1/4 teaspoon ground ginger
•
1/4 teaspoon ground coriander
•
2 tablespoons brandy
•
2 tablespoons dark rum
